American Riviera Orchard, Markle's latest venture, was unveiled last month through a newly established Instagram page adorned with the brand's logo—a crest symbolizing its identity. A corresponding website invites potential customers to join a waiting list, signaling the anticipation of the brand's full-scale debut.

Offering an array of products, from home decor and gourmet jams to pet accessories, the brand aims to carve out its niche in the lifestyle domain. Additionally, rumors have surfaced about a complementary cooking show set to launch on Netflix, further expanding Markle's footprint in the digital and entertainment landscape.

Daily Express reported that Lynn Carratt, a PR specialist from Press Box PR, offered nuanced advice to the Duchess, considering Princess Kate's and King Charles's ongoing treatment.

Carratt suggested, "As Meghan is no longer part of the Monarchy, she is free to launch her brand whenever she likes. However, given Kate's ongoing cancer treatments, it would be wise for Meghan to be sensitive to the timing of her brand launch, considering the public support for Kate worldwide."

The expert recommended that Markle advance her brand's development discreetly. A period of low public visibility and behind-the-scenes work on her brand could allow for a more favorable reception in light of the royal family's current challenges.

"Meghan should keep a low profile and show support for her in-laws publicly," Carratt advised. This strategy could enable the Duchess to pursue her business aspirations without detracting from the royal family's public image or appearing insensitive to their health struggles.
